How to Make Hot Chocolate for Concession Stand

Assuming you would like a blog post discussing how to make hot chocolate for a concession stand: Hot chocolate is a winter classic and definitely something you should have available at your concession stand! People will be looking for a warm drink to help them thaw out, so make sure you’re prepared with this simple recipe.

You can make a big batch ahead of time and keep it warm in a slow cooker or on the stovetop. Just follow these easy steps and you’ll have delicious hot chocolate ready to go in no time!

Ingredients:

-1 cup milk (you can also use non-dairy milk)

-1/4 cup cocoa powder

-3 tablespoons sugar (or more, to taste)

-1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ract Optional toppings:

-Whipped cream

-Mini marshmallows

-‘Snow’ made from shaved chocolate or coconut flakes Instructions:

1. Heat the milk in a saucepan over medium heat. whisk in the cocoa powder, sugar, and vanilla extract until combined.

2. Continue heating, stirring occasionally, until the mixture comes to a simmer.

Then turn off the heat and serve immediately with your desired toppings. Enjoy!

How Do You Keep Hot Chocolate Warm for a Crowd?

When hosting a hot chocolate party for a large group, there are a few things you can do to keep the hot chocolate warm throughout the event. First, make sure to use a large enough pot or slow cooker to accommodate all of the hot chocolate. If possible, heat the milk on the stovetop before adding the chocolate so that it doesn’t have to spend as long in the warmer.

You can also add a little bit of water to the milk when heating it to help prevent scorching. Once the hot chocolate is made, keep it in an insulated container or thermos. If using a slow cooker, set it to “warm” or the lowest setting so that it doesn’t continue to cook the chocolate and make it bitter.

Stir occasionally to help distribute the heat evenly. To keep things extra cozy, provide guests with blankets or lap throws and set up a fire if you have one!
